📢 Key Event
Omnitech reported Q1 FY27 revenue growth of 61.5% YoY to INR116 crores and PAT growth of 468.7% YoY to INR29.7 crores, with a strong INR3,000 crores order book and FY28 growth guidance of 35-40%.
🔄 What Changed
PAT growth accelerated to 468.7% YoY and EBITDA grew 90.8% YoY, reflecting improved profitability and operational efficiency. The order book increased to INR3,000 crores, signaling sustained demand. Capex of INR250 crores was confirmed for FY27 with minor spillover into FY28, targeting capacity expansion to 42-43 lakhs machine hours. Gross margin guidance of 68-71% was reaffirmed despite rising raw material costs, which increased to 28% sequentially.
🔮 What's Next
Management guided FY28 revenue growth of 35-40% and margins exceeding 30%, with capex of INR250 crores planned over three years to scale capacity and achieve ROCE above 20%. Defense/aerospace revenue is expected to materialize gradually post-FA approvals, with new customer approvals in motion control and automation expected within 6-15 months.
💡 Investor Takeaway
The company is scaling capacity with disciplined capex and margin expansion, supported by a deep order book and improving working capital, positioning it for sustained growth beyond oil & gas into higher-margin segments like motion control and automation.
